HOW IS EBOLA SPREAD? Ebola spreads through direct contact with: blood, vomit, stool and urine, infected animals. Ebola signs and symptoms usually start 2 to 21 days after exposure. Call toll free: 0800 100 066 or 0800 203 033 #WUYA#WakeUpYouthsAfrica#EbolaOutbreak
On 11th April 2026, WUYA partnered with the Antimicrobial Resistance Club at KIU WC for a community outreach. We provided health education, screening & treatment to underserved community members.
We remain committed to supporting community health. #AMR#KIUWC@RHUganda
